Your comments confirm a real problem and that is that ego and pride make youth think they have all the answers and can do things so much better than those who have come before. Youth are more idealistic and tend to see things this way, so it is not totally unusual. Can youth change politics? They certainly need to be involved. First of all, the decisions made today are what they will be living with as adults. When they are old enough they can vote smart. Secondly youth have plenty of energy and enthusiasm which is often needed. Thrid, but not least, the ideas of youth need to be heard and considered. Because youth do look at situations from a fresh perspective, it can lead to some creative solutions. On the other hand, the perspective of youth is not balanced with the reality of experience. That is why youth cannot talk as if they will just drop all of the old generation and their ideas. The successes and failures of the previous generations provide lots of valuable information that may allow a new generation to find the path of success sooner. In some ways the problems people face are different from one generation to the next. In many ways the problems, although dressed differently, are the same because people characteristics are the same.
